Troubleshooting Chart - continued
Problem Display / Symptom Cause Check Action
Error Code:
C534 - continued
C534: STERILIZE MODE
STEAM TEMP LOW
ITEMS NOT STERILE
UNPLUG / REPLUG UNIT
During Sterilization Mode, chamber
temperature dropped below the
cycles designated sterilization
temperature.
Pressure Leaks. - continued
Leaking or defective Pressure Relief
Valve. Check for water / steam leakage
from beneath the rear of the sterilizer.
Perform: Pressure Relief Valve Test
Replace pressure relief valve.
Pressure transducer tubing leaking.
Check for steam leakage at pressure
transducer tubing connections.
Secure pressure transducer tubing
connections with high temperature cable ties.
Check all plumbing fitting connections for
leakage.
Tighten or replace fittings.
Heating element malfunctioning.
Inspect heating element. Heating element
should lay flat in the bottom of the chamber.
Heating element should be free of any
flaking / pitting. Perform: Heating Element
Resistance Test (should read 9-11 Ω)
Replace heating element.
PC Board malfunctioning.
Perform:
Heating Element Supply Voltage Test
(With harness attached to leads should
have line voltage in test mode)
Replace Main PC board.
Perform: Main PC Board Relay Test
(Check TP1 & TP2 for an acceptable range:
10 to 14 VDC)
Perform: Main PC Board Pressure
Transducer Voltage Test
(Acceptable range: 4.0 to 6.0 VDC)
